Skip to main content

조직 또는 엔터프라이즈에 대한 MCP 서버 접근을 구성하십시오.

MCP 레지스트리 URL 및 엑세스 제어 정책을 구성하여 개발자가 지원되는 IDE에서 GitHub Copilot를 사용하여 검색하고 사용할 수 있는 MCP 서버를 결정할 수 있습니다.

누가 이 기능을 사용할 수 있나요?

Enterprise owners and organization owners

Copilot Enterprise or Copilot Business

참고

MCP 레지스트리 URL 및 허용 목록은 공개 미리 보기에 있으며 변경될 수 있습니다.

필수 조건

회사의 MCP 서버에 대한 접근을 완전히 구성하려면 먼저 MCP 레지스트리를 만들어야 합니다. 조직 또는 엔터프라이즈에 대한 MCP 레지스트리 구성을(를) 참조하세요.

엔터프라이즈용 MCP 허용 목록 정책 구성

균일한 access 보장하기 위해 엔터프라이즈 수준에서 MCP 레지스트리 URL 및 허용 목록 정책을 설정하고 유지 관리할 수 있습니다. 그렇지 않으면 팀에 요구 사항이 다른 경우 각 조직에 대해 별도의 정책을 구성해야 합니다.

  1. 귀하의 기업으로 이동하세요. 예를 들어 GitHub.com의 Enterprises 페이지에서.

  2. 페이지 맨 위에서 AI 컨트롤을 클릭합니다.

  3. 사이드바에서 MCP를 클릭하세요.

  4.        **Copilot의 MCP 서버**가 **모든 위치에서 활성화**로 설정되어 있는지 확인합니다.
    
  5.        **MCP 레지스트리 URL** 섹션에서 레지스트리의 URL을 입력한 다음 **저장**을 클릭합니다.
    
  6. 레지스트리 서버에 대한 Restrict MCP access 섹션에서 드롭다운 메뉴를 선택하고 다음 옵션 중 하나를 클릭합니다. * 모두 허용: 제한 없음. 모든 MCP 서버를 사용할 수 있습니다. * 레지스트리 전용: 레지스트리에 있는 서버만 실행할 수 있습니다.

    선택한 정책은 엔터프라이즈의 개발자에게 즉시 적용됩니다.

조직용 MCP 허용 목록 정책 구성

  1. GitHub의 오른쪽 위 모서리에서 프로필 사진을 클릭한 다음, Your organizations를 클릭합니다.

  2. 조직을 클릭하여 선택합니다.

  3. 조직 이름에서 설정을 클릭합니다. "설정" 탭이 표시되지 않으면 드롭다운 메뉴를 선택한 다음 설정을 클릭합니다.

    조직 프로필에 있는 여러 탭의 스크린샷. "설정" 탭이 진한 주황색으로 표시됩니다.

  4. 사이드바의 "Code, planning, and automation"에서 Copilot 을 클릭한 다음, Policies를 클릭합니다.

  5. "기능" 섹션에서 Copilot의 MCP 서버를****활성화로 설정되어 있는지 확인합니다.

  6.        **MCP 레지스트리 URL(선택 사항)** 필드에 레지스트리의 URL을 입력한 다음 **저장**을 클릭합니다.
    

    참고

    Azure API 센터를 사용하여 MCP 레지스트리를 설정하는 경우 API 센터의 기본 URL을 입력합니다. 경로 접미사 /v0.1/servers를 포함하면 레지스트리가 오류를 발생시킵니다.

  7. 레지스트리 서버에 대한 Restrict MCP access 섹션에서 드롭다운 메뉴를 선택하고 다음 옵션 중 하나를 클릭합니다. * 모두 허용: 제한 없음. 모든 MCP 서버를 사용할 수 있습니다. * 레지스트리 전용: 레지스트리에 있는 서버만 실행할 수 있습니다.

    선택한 조직은 엔터프라이즈의 개발자에게 즉시 적용됩니다.

다음 단계

MCP 허용 목록 적용 및 제한 사항에 대한 자세한 내용은 MCP 허용 목록 적용을 참조하세요.